Improved surgical techniques and organ preservation, understanding of immunologic barriers, and the development of newer and more potent immunosuppressives have combined to improve survival of transplant patients and grafts. Rejection remains the major barrier to long-term graft survival in patients, organ transplantation therapy is highly dependent on the success of immunosuppressants to suppress the recipient’s immune responses to the foreign organ.

Most transplant patients require lifelong immunosuppressive therapy to prevent rejection, except when human leukocyte antigen (HLA)-identical transplants are used. The number of organ transplants performed worldwide is approximately 70,000 annually. As medical science extends the life expectancy of patients with transplanted organs, demand continues to increase for safe, effective immunosuppressants to control transplant rejection.
